APCO seeks input on Data Exchange Standard
The US-based Association of Public-Safety Communications Officials (APCO) International has called for comments on the revision of the candidate American National Standard (ANS) APCO ANS 2.103.2-201x Public Safety Communications Common Incident Types for Data Exchange.
The revision aims to ensure that the standard continues to provide emergency communications centre (ECC) managers with a standard directory of incident type codes, to promote effective information exchange between Next Generation 911 ECCs and other agencies.
“The ability to efficiently share information between disparate ECCs and other agencies is a critical component of interoperability,” said Holly Wayt, President of APCO International.
The candidate standard document can be viewed online, with feedback due by 16 September 2019.
